🎯 Why?
PEP544 gave Python protocols, a way to define duck typing statically. This library gives you some niceties to make common idioms easier.
📦 Installation
pip install quacks
⚠️ For type checking to work with mypy, you’ll need to enable the plugin in your mypy config file:
[mypy]
plugins = quacks.mypy
⭐️ Features
Easy read-only protocols
Defining read-only protocols is great for encouraging immutability and working with frozen dataclasses. Use the readonly decorator:
from quacks import readonly
@readonly
class User(Protocol):
id: int
name: str
is_premium: bool
Without this decorator, we’d have to write quite a lot of cruft, reducing readability:
class User(Protocol):
@property
def id(self) -> int: ...
@property
def name(self) -> str: ...
@property
def is_premium(self) -> bool: ...
